The nickel/indium/bismuth sulfate and inckel/indium/bismuth sulfamate plating baths were prepared similarly. Preparation of one liter of the sulfate and sulfamate formulations is outlined below. Citric acid (57 grams) is dissolved in 300 ml of deionized water heated to 45° C. Nickel carbonate (45 grams) is then dissolved in the solution. The pH of the bath at this point should be about 4.0. Nickel chloride (15 or 75 grams/liter of nickel chloride hexahydrate for the sulfate and sulfamate plating baths, respectively) and nickel sulfate (300 grams/liter of nickel sulfate hexahydrate or 350 grams/liter of nickel sulfamate hexahydrate) are then added. The solution is brought up to a volume of 1L by addition of deionized water and the pH of the bath is adjusted to 3.2 either with nickel carbonate or sulfuric/sulfamic acid. Indium metal is then added electrochemically. Indium metal (either strips or shot in an anode basket) is dissolved anodically at about 5 amps/dm2. The cathode current density should be greater than about 50 amps/dm2. Current is applied until the indium reaches the desired concentration, e.g. 2.5 grams/liter for the sulfate formulation and 5 grams/liter for the sulfamate bath. Bismuth in solution form is then added. Bismuth is added as an HCl solution prepared by dissolving sodium bismuthate in 20% HCl, precipitating a white solid by the addition of water, filtering and redissolving the solid in 20% HCl. The bismuth concentration is varied from 0.1-3.0 g/L metal in the sulfate system and from 0.2-2.0 g/L metal in the sulfamate system.
